Advanced Ultra-Low Temperature Freezer: Precision and Efficiency Redefined

Product Description

The Lab LCD Touch Screen Ultra-Low Temperature Freezer YR05298 is an exceptional scientific tool designed for the most demanding laboratory environments. Operating between -40°C to -86°C, it ensures the preservation of sensitive samples with high reliability. This model is characterized by a straightforward manual defrost system and direct cooling technology, which is complemented by a stainless steel interior that guarantees both durability and ease of cleaning.

Equipped with a dual SECOP compressor system and a microprocessor-controlled temperature controller, it delivers efficient cooling performance. The freezer features an LCD touch display for precise temperature monitoring, while the spacious 408-liter capacity, divided into 16 racks and capable of holding up to 28,800 2ml samples, meets extensive storage needs.

Frequently Asked Questions

How often do you need to defrost the freezer?

The freezer features a manual defrost system, which should be done periodically based on the level of frost buildup observed. Regular maintenance ensures optimal efficiency.

Is there a backup system during power failures?

Yes, the freezer is equipped with a power failure backup alarm that can function up to 72 hours, ensuring preservation even during outages.

Benefits and Drawbacks

Advantages: The YR05298 model guarantees precise temperature control and excellent storage capability, accommodating up to 28,800 samples. Its dual SECOP compressors optimize cooling efficiency, and the LCD touch interface provides user-friendly navigation.

Disadvantages: The manual defrost feature may require more frequent user intervention compared to automatic systems, which is important to consider in high-demand laboratory settings.

Recommendations

For optimal performance, it is recommended to install the freezer in an environment within its specified ambient temperature range of 10~32°C. Regularly check and maintain the unit by following the manufacturer’s guidelines, particularly focusing on routine cleaning of the condenser and manual defrosting as needed. Utilizing these practices will maximize the freezer’s lifespan and effectiveness.
